Web• The NRCS unit dimensionless hydrograph may not be used when the computation interval is greater than 0.29 times the lag time of the watershed. This limitation translates into a minimum time of concentration of 5.75 minutes which typically occurs in watersheds of 3 acres or less. The result of exceeding this limitation is that the resulting

The conceptual and empirical foundations of the runoff curve number means are reviewed. The method is a conceptual model of hydrologic abstracted of storm rainfall. Its objective is to estimate direct runoff depth from storm rainfall depth, based at a parameter referral to as the curve number.
